Pompey, NY is a small town located in upstate New York with a population of just over 7,000 people. Despite its serene and picturesque surroundings, the town has experienced its fair share of crime. According to recent statistics, the violent crime rate in Pompey is 7.3, which is significantly lower than the national average of 22.7. However, the property crime rate in Pompey is 17.7, which is slightly lower than the US average of 35.4.
